Why Is There a MOQ for PVC Tarp?
During the procurement of PVC tarp rolls, many buyers ask the same question: why is the MOQ for PVC tarp usually higher than expected? For buyers who only need a small or medium batch for truck covers, outdoor storage, construction protection, agricultural use, or warehouse covering, the minimum order quantity can sometimes feel like a barrier.
However, the MOQ for PVC knife-coated tarpaulin is not simply an artificial rule set by manufacturers. It is closely related to the way PVC tarpaulin is produced, the cost structure behind each production run, and the supply chain of base fabric, PVC resin, additives, and color materials.
Understanding these factors helps buyers make better purchasing decisions. Instead of only comparing the MOQ number, buyers can evaluate whether to choose stock materials, standard specifications, customized production, or long-term staged purchasing. This article explains why PVC tarp has MOQ requirements and how buyers can plan orders more efficiently.
What Is PVC Knife-Coated Tarpaulin?
PVC knife-coated tarpaulin is an industrial fabric made by coating high-strength polyester base fabric with PVC material. Compared with ordinary temporary covering materials, PVC tarpaulin is designed for better waterproof performance, abrasion resistance, flexibility, tensile strength, and outdoor durability.
It is widely used in:
• Truck covers and trailer curtains
• Outdoor equipment covers
• Construction site protection
• Warehouse and logistics storage
• Agricultural covers
• Industrial partitions and covers
• Inflatable products
• Flexible water tanks
• Large-area outdoor tarpaulin projects
Because PVC tarp is not produced piece by piece like a simple fabric product, its MOQ is usually affected by continuous coating production, raw material supply, color matching, roll width, formulation requirements, and production start-up costs.
1. PVC Tarp Is Produced on Continuous Industrial Coating Lines
The first reason for a higher PVC tarp MOQ is the production method itself.
PVC knife-coated tarpaulin is usually manufactured on a continuous coating line. The process may include base fabric unwinding, PVC paste coating, blade adjustment, heating, gelation, cooling, surface treatment, embossing, trimming, inspection, and rewinding.
This is not a small manual process that can be started and stopped freely. Before production begins, technicians need to adjust several key parameters, such as:
• Coating thickness
• Blade gap and pressure
• Oven temperature
• Production speed
• Fabric tension
• Surface texture
• Color consistency
• Weight and thickness tolerance
Once the line starts running, it needs to remain stable to ensure consistent coating adhesion, surface quality, waterproof performance, and thickness control. If the line is frequently stopped for very small orders, it can reduce production efficiency and increase the risk of uneven coating, color variation, wrinkles, or unstable physical performance.
For this reason, manufacturers usually need a reasonable minimum production volume to keep the coating line operating efficiently and consistently. This is one of the most important reasons why PVC tarpaulin MOQ is higher than many ordinary textile products.
2. Raw Materials Are Supplied in Large Industrial Batches
The second reason comes from the upstream supply chain.
PVC tarp production depends on several types of raw materials, including polyester base fabric, PVC resin, plasticizers, stabilizers, pigments, flame-retardant additives, anti-mildew agents, UV-resistant additives, and other formulation materials.
These materials are not usually purchased in very small quantities. For example, polyester base fabric is commonly supplied in large rolls. PVC resin and additives are often purchased in bags, drums, or bulk packaging. Color pigments and masterbatches also have their own minimum preparation quantities.
This means the tarpaulin manufacturer must also follow the batch requirements of upstream suppliers. If a buyer requests only a very small customized order, the manufacturer may still need to purchase or prepare raw materials in a much larger quantity than the actual order requires.
This supply chain structure directly affects the MOQ of custom PVC tarp rolls. The smaller the order, the harder it is to spread the raw material preparation cost across the final product.
3. Full-Roll Production Determines the Basic Order Unit
PVC tarpaulin is usually produced and supplied in rolls. Common roll widths may vary depending on the factory’s equipment and product series, and roll lengths are often designed for efficient production, storage, transport, and later cutting or fabrication.
For coated fabric, roll integrity is important. During production, the base fabric must run under controlled tension and temperature. The coating layer also needs enough continuous running length to stabilize. Producing only a very short customized length may cause higher waste at the beginning and end of the production run.
In many cases, the practical MOQ is related to the roll width, roll length, fabric type, coating weight, and whether the order uses an existing standard material or a customized specification.
For buyers, this means MOQ is not only a sales policy. It is often linked to the physical production unit of PVC tarpaulin rolls.
4. Start-Up Cost Must Be Spread Across the Order Quantity
Every PVC tarp production run involves fixed start-up costs before stable output is achieved.
These costs may include:
• Equipment preparation
• Heating and temperature stabilization
• Labor for machine adjustment
• Trial coating and quality checking
• Color matching and formulation testing
• Material waste during initial setup
• Cleaning and changeover between different colors or formulas
These costs occur whether the final order is small or large. If the order quantity is too small, the start-up cost per meter becomes very high. As a result, the final unit price may become much higher than buyers expect.
This is why manufacturers usually set MOQ requirements to make production economically practical. A reasonable MOQ helps spread fixed costs across more meters of fabric, keeping the unit price more competitive and stable.
5. Custom Colors and Special Formulas Increase MOQ
Standard PVC tarp materials usually have lower purchasing pressure because manufacturers may keep popular colors and specifications in stock. However, customized requirements often increase MOQ.
Common custom requirements include:
• Specific color matching
• Custom width
• Special weight or thickness
• Flame-retardant performance
• UV resistance
• Anti-mildew treatment
• Cold resistance
• Anti-static performance
• Double-sided coating differences
• Special surface texture or embossing
For example, if a buyer requires a specific Pantone color, the factory may need to prepare a dedicated color paste or pigment formula. If the buyer requires flame-retardant PVC tarp, the production formula may need different additives and additional testing. If the buyer requires a unique surface texture, special embossing rollers or production settings may be needed.
These custom requirements often involve extra preparation, testing, cleaning, and material loss. Therefore, the MOQ for customized PVC tarpaulin is usually higher than standard stock materials.
6. Tooling or Special Surface Requirements May Require Higher Volume
Some PVC tarp products require special tooling or processing, such as embossed surfaces, anti-slip textures, laminated structures, or unique composite designs.
If a buyer needs a customized texture or special pattern, the manufacturer may need to use a specific embossing roller or additional processing equipment. In some cases, new tooling must be developed. This creates additional cost before mass production begins.
Tooling cost cannot be absorbed by a very small order. It must be spread across a larger production volume. Therefore, the more customized the product is, the more likely it is to require a higher MOQ.
This is common in industrial materials. Customization is possible, but the order volume must support the cost of development and production.
7. Quality Consistency Requires Stable Batch Production
PVC tarpaulin is often used in outdoor and industrial environments where performance matters. Buyers usually care about waterproofing, tensile strength, tear resistance, peeling strength, color consistency, flexibility, flame-retardant performance, and service life.
To maintain stable quality, manufacturers prefer to produce each batch under consistent conditions. A stable production batch helps ensure:
• Uniform coating thickness
• Consistent color
• Stable fabric tension
• Better coating adhesion
• Lower defect rate
• More reliable physical performance
• Easier quality inspection and traceability
Very small fragmented orders can increase the difficulty of quality control. From a manufacturing perspective, MOQ helps keep production stable and quality more consistent.
How Can Buyers Reduce MOQ Pressure?
Although MOQ is a real part of PVC tarp production, buyers still have several practical ways to reduce purchasing pressure.
1. Choose Standard Stock PVC Tarp Materials
The easiest way to reduce MOQ pressure is to choose stock or commonly produced specifications.
Manufacturers may keep standard PVC tarp rolls in popular colors, weights, and widths. These materials are often suitable for general waterproof covering, truck covers, warehouse protection, temporary outdoor use, and many industrial applications.
For standard materials, buyers may benefit from:
• Lower MOQ
• Faster delivery
• More stable pricing
• Proven specifications
• Easier sampling
• Less customization cost
If the project does not require a special color or unique technical performance, choosing standard stock material is often the most cost-effective option.
2. Use Regular Colors and Common Specifications
Custom color is one of the common reasons for higher MOQ. If the buyer can accept regular colors such as blue, white, grey, green, black, or other commonly produced shades, the MOQ may be easier to manage.
The same applies to fabric weight and width. Standard weights and widths are usually easier to arrange than unusual custom combinations.
Before confirming a custom order, buyers can ask the manufacturer:
• Do you have similar stock material?
• Is there a regular color close to my requirement?
• Which width has the best production efficiency?
• Which weight is most commonly produced?
• Can my order be arranged with an existing production batch?
This communication can help buyers find a balance between performance, price, MOQ, and delivery time.
3. Plan Annual Demand and Arrange Staged Delivery
For buyers with repeated demand, a better solution is to plan purchasing based on monthly, quarterly, or annual usage.
Instead of placing many small urgent orders, buyers can consolidate demand into a larger production order and negotiate staged delivery with the manufacturer. This approach helps meet MOQ requirements while reducing warehouse pressure.
For example, the buyer may confirm a larger total order quantity but request delivery in several batches according to project progress or inventory capacity.
This method can help buyers achieve:
• Better unit price
• More stable supply
• Lower production risk
• Better inventory planning
• Reduced urgent-order costs
For long-term users of PVC tarpaulin, staged delivery is often more efficient than frequent small orders.
4. Work With Distributors or Consolidated Orders
For buyers who need a small quantity of customized material, working through distributors or consolidated purchasing may be an option.
Distributors can combine demand from multiple customers and place larger orders with the manufacturer. Some manufacturers may also arrange compatible orders together when different buyers need similar colors, formulas, or specifications.
This shared production model can reduce MOQ pressure, especially when the requested material is close to a regular product series.
However, buyers should confirm quality standards, delivery time, and specification consistency clearly before using this approach.
5. Discuss Alternatives Instead of Only Requesting a Lower MOQ
When MOQ seems too high, buyers often ask the factory to simply reduce it. A better approach is to discuss alternatives.
For example, the buyer can ask:
• Is there an existing material close to my specification?
• Can we use a regular color instead of a custom color?
• Can the order be combined with another production batch?
• Can we start with stock material for testing?
• Can future orders use the same formula to reduce setup cost?
• Can you suggest a more economical specification?
Experienced manufacturers can often recommend practical options that reduce cost and improve feasibility without compromising the application.
MOQ Is Not Just a Quantity Rule
MOQ for PVC tarp is not only about how much a factory wants to sell. It reflects the reality of industrial production.
PVC knife-coated tarpaulin requires continuous coating equipment, stable raw material supply, formulation preparation, production setup, quality control, and full-roll handling. These factors all influence the minimum order quantity.
For standard PVC tarp rolls, MOQ may be more flexible. For customized PVC tarpaulin, especially with special colors, flame-retardant requirements, UV resistance, unique widths, or special surface textures, MOQ is usually higher because production preparation and material costs increase.
Understanding this logic helps buyers make better decisions instead of seeing MOQ as a simple obstacle.
FAQ
1. Why is the MOQ for PVC tarp higher than ordinary fabric?
PVC tarp is produced through industrial coating lines, not simple cutting and sewing. Each production run requires equipment setup, material preparation, temperature control, coating adjustment, and quality inspection. These fixed costs make small-batch production less economical.
2. Can I buy PVC tarp below the MOQ?
It depends on the specification. If the manufacturer has stock material, a lower quantity may be possible. If the product requires custom color, special formula, custom width, or special coating, the MOQ is usually harder to reduce.
3. Does custom color increase PVC tarpaulin MOQ?
Yes. Custom color usually requires pigment preparation, color matching, testing, and production cleaning. If the color is not a regular shade, the MOQ may be higher than standard colors.
4. How can I reduce the MOQ for custom PVC tarp?
You can choose standard colors, use common widths and weights, accept similar stock materials, plan long-term demand, arrange staged delivery, or ask whether your order can be combined with a compatible production batch.
5. Is higher MOQ always bad for buyers?
Not necessarily. A reasonable MOQ can help reduce unit cost, improve production stability, and ensure consistent quality. For buyers with long-term demand, larger planned orders are often more cost-effective than repeated small urgent orders.
